Mouse does not work in DL380G2
There are Remote Insight Board in the server. Mouse and keyboard are connected to cutoff point on motherboard. Compaq tests for point device completed successfully. Mouse itself is working on any other computer.
When the remote insight board was removed from server, mouse has still not working as before. And compaq tests have point at mouse port controller (poining device)is absent.
Please suggest me what is the matter?

Re: Mouse does not work in DL380G2
Hi
I remember that RILOE II in DL380G2 must connected a 30 pins cable to the backbone, and plugin the first pci slot. It??s Ok?

Re: Mouse does not work in DL380G2
Hi
What Firmware version have you got? If you have 1.02, upgrade to 1.02A beta.
